TP钱包找不到币的系统性分析与实务建议

摘要:当用户在TP钱包中看不到自己的币时,问题既可能出在链层、代币信息、钱包客户端,也可能出在监控与后端服务。本文从排查流程、实时监控、平台架构、多币种支持、安全防护与数字签名等角度,给出系统化分析与可操作建议。

一、常见原因与快速排查步骤

1) 网络与链选择错误:检查当前网络(如以太坊、BSC、HECO、TRON)是否选择正确,主网/测试网切换会导致余额显示为空。2) 代币未添加或合约地址错误:ERC-20/BEP-20等代币需手动添加合约地址、精度(decimals)与代币符号。3) 节点/RPC不同步或自定义RPC错误:钱包依赖的RPC节点若不同步或被篡改,会导致查询余额失败。4) 交易未确认或失败:正在挂起的转账、nonce问题或重放攻击可能造成余额异常。5) 账号导入/助记词错误:使用错误的助记词或导入为只读地址会看不到资产。6) 缓存与UI问题:本地缓存损坏、客户端版本过旧亦会导致显示问题。

二、系统性排查流程(建议操作顺序)

1) 在区块链浏览器上用地址确认余额和交易记录;2) 核对网络与合约地址;3) 切换或添加可靠的公共RPC(Infura、Alchemy、公共BSC节点等);4) 手动添加自定义代币并填写合约地址与decimals;5) 检查是否为代币跨链场景(桥接延迟/锁定);6) 若仍异常,导出交易记录并联系官方客服,避免输入私钥给第三方。

三、实时支付监控与告警机制

- 部署基于WebSocket/mempool的实时监听,捕获未确认交易、异常gas消耗与链上回滚;- 设置多维告警:余额突变、非本地发起的大额转出、异常nonce增长;- 将链上事件映射到用户视图,提供可追溯的时间线与证据链。

四、多币种支持与平台设计要点

- 抽象账户/资产层:统一管理UTXO型(如比特币)与账户型(如以太坊)差异;- 模块化代币适配器:支持ERC-20/BEP-20/TRC-20/SPL等,便于快速接入新链与跨链桥;- 统一单位与精度处理,避免精度丢失导致“看不到”小数额。

五、高效数据保护与私钥管理

- 私钥安全:优先支持设备端加密、安全元件(SE)、硬件钱包与门限签名(MPC);- 储存加密:使用成熟KMS/HSM保存后端密钥,严格最小权限与审计;- 备份与恢复:助记词/私钥导出流程必须在离线、受控环境中完成,限制导出频次与提示风险。

六、数字签名与交易验证策略

- 支持多种签名算法(ECDSA、EdDSA)与链特定签名格式;- 使用确定性签名(RFC6979)降低随机数漏洞风险;- 提供交易预签名与离线签名能力,结合验证器在服务端核验交易原文与签名一致性。

七、创新科技发展方向(建议)

- 引入Layer2/聚合器以降低手续费并提升UX;- 采用账户抽象(AA)与社交恢复方案改善助记词问题;- 使用零知识证明(ZK)提高隐私保护并实现高效跨链证明;- 研发智能监控与反诈AI,以实时识别异常交互并自动提示用户。

八、应急与运营建议

- 建立标准化SOP:包括用户报备、链上证据采集、联合风控与速响应通道;- 定期演练恢复流程与钥匙轮换;- 提供透明的用户引导文档,减少因误操作导致的“看不到币”。

结论:TP钱包找不到币通常是多因素叠加的结果,既有客户端与链交互问题,也有代币接入与安全管理不足。通过建立完善的实时支付监控、模块化多币种支持、强固的数据保护与现代化数字签名方案,并结合创新技术(如L2、账号抽象、MPC与ZK),可以显著降低此类问题发生的概率并提升用户体验。

作者:陈辰科技发布时间:2026-01-16 21:15:45

评论

Tech小王

很全面的排查流程,尤其是区块链浏览器核验这一步很实用。

Alice_88

关于多币种适配器的设计,很希望看到具体实现案例或开源库推荐。

链安研究员

建议把MPC与硬件钱包的成本与适配复杂度也列一下,便于团队决策。

萌新小李

我之前就是因为网络选错导致看不到币,文章第一段直接就命中痛点了。

CryptoFan

实时监控与mempool监听的部分讲得很好,能否补充Webhook与消息队列的部署建议?

相关阅读